Summary

In 2013, the NHS started a vaccination program in some regions of England to provide free flu
 vaccines to children aged 2 years or older, and younger than 16 years. The program has since
 been rolled out across England. Most children are given a vaccine that is sprayed into their
 nose. In clinical trials, this vaccine has been shown to protect children from experiencing
 severe flu symptoms. It is important to describe how it is used, and what happens to children
 who receive it in the wider community. This evidence will help the NHS to check that the
 vaccine roll out runs as planned and produces the intended benefits.
 
 This study aims to: (1) describe how many children each year receive flu vaccines, and
 describe the characteristics of children who are and aren't vaccinated for influenza; (2)
 test how often children receiving the vaccine see their GP or a hospital doctor for symptoms
 related to flu, compared to those who don't; and (3) to test what groups of children are more
 or less likely to receive a flu vaccine. To answer these objectives, the study will use the
 Clinical Practice Research Datalink, linked to Hospital Episode Statistics and the Office for
 National Statistics database.
